Ying Cheng is a scholar working on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, Management of Technology and Innovation and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Ying Cheng has authored 76 papers receiving a total of 3.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 46 papers in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, 24 papers in Management of Technology and Innovation and 11 papers in Information Systems. Recurrent topics in Ying Cheng’s work include Digital Transformation in Industry (35 papers), Collaboration in agile enterprises (20 papers) and Flexible and Reconfigurable Manufacturing Systems (12 papers). Ying Cheng is often cited by papers focused on Digital Transformation in Industry (35 papers), Collaboration in agile enterprises (20 papers) and Flexible and Reconfigurable Manufacturing Systems (12 papers). Ying Cheng coll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Ying Cheng's co-authors include Fei Tao, Zhang Li, Li Da Xu, Bo Li, Yongping Zhang, Yongkui Liu, Liangjin Zhao, V.C. Venkatesh, Yue Luo and Hua Guo and has published in prestigious journ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, Expert Systems with Applications and ACS Sustainable Chemistry & Engineering.
